Across Xinjiang, communities are celebrating Rouzi Festival (Eid al-Fitr) with joyful traditions. Urumqi's Grand Bazaar features red lanterns and vibrant bowl and eagle dances. In Kashgar, residents in colorful attire dance together at People's Square and the Old City, warmly welcoming visitors. Markets buzz with shoppers buying flowers and dried fruits. From cities to villages, the festival unites people in dance, laughter, and shared joy.
